Rhyming tips for songwriters
When using "tocqueville" in your lyrics, consider mixing perfect rhymes with near rhymes (slant rhymes) for a more natural flow. Perfect rhymes like vaudeville, bougainville, libreville create a satisfying resolution, while slant rhymes add variety and keep listeners engaged.
Since "tocqueville" has 4 syllables, try matching it with words of similar length for a balanced meter. Multi-syllable rhymes often sound more sophisticated than single-syllable pairs.
